Subject: Re: [PATCH 2/3] mmc: omap_hsmmc: use slot-gpio library for gpio support.

On 11 December 2014 at 22:43, NeilBrown <neilb@...e.de> wrote:
> Using the common code removes some code duplication, and
> makes it easier to switch to using mmc_of_parse() which
> will remove more duplication.
>
> As hsmmc has a slightly different interrupt service routine
> for card-detect, enhance slot-gpio to allow an alternate
> routine to be provided.
>
> Signed-off-by: NeilBrown <neilb@...e.de>
> ---
>  drivers/mmc/core/slot-gpio.c  |   24 ++++++++++++++-
>  drivers/mmc/host/omap_hsmmc.c |   67 +++++++++--------------------------------
>  include/linux/mmc/slot-gpio.h |    2 +
>  3 files changed, 39 insertions(+), 54 deletions(-)

I like the looks of this patch, still I want the mmc core parts to be
separated into it's own patch. Can you please split this up.

Kind regards
Uffe
